📈 Chart & Trend Analysis

  • Moving Averages: Current price (₹73.2) is below both 50 DMA (₹75.1) and 200 DMA (₹80.6), confirming bearish momentum.
  • RSI: At 42.8, the stock is in neutral-to-weak territory, not oversold yet.
  • MACD: Negative (-0.38), indicating mild bearish pressure.
  • Bollinger Bands: Price is near the lower band, suggesting weakness but potential for mean reversion.
  • Volume Trends: Current volume (21,53,025) is significantly below 1-week average (47,60,431), showing declining participation.

📉 Trend Status

The stock is currently in a downtrend with weak momentum and low volume. Consolidation may occur near ₹70 – ₹72, but reversal requires stronger buying signals above ₹80.
